About
Under normal circ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of the fund’s net assets in securities of emerging market companies excluding companies domiciled, or whose stock is listed for trading on an exchange, in China, as well as companies domiciled in Hong Kong. Putnam Management invests significantly in small and mid-size companies. In evaluating potential investments, Putnam Management seeks high-quality companies with mispriced earnings growth that can potentially deliver excess return over the fund’s benchmark. The fund is non-diversified.
